Shahbaz Sharif – The Khadim-e-Ala Punjab

Shahbaz Sharif younger brother to the thrice-elected Prime Minister Nawaz Sharif has himself served thrice as Chief Minister Punjab. Considered a man addicted to his work, Shahbaz Sharif referred to being called as ‘Khadim e Ala’ (chief servant) rather than chief minister.  Elected as President of Lahore Chamber of Commerce and Industries in 1985, he was elected MPA to the Punjab assembly in 1988 and leader of the Opposition in the same assembly in 1993. Setting aside politics, he is one influential businessman, being the joint owner of the Ittefaq Group of Companies.

As Chief Minister of Punjab, Shahbaz introduced far-reaching policies and adopted revolutionary innovations in almost every sector. He has more to his list in the agriculture, health, law and order, social welfare and education sector than anyone of his contemporaries. This totally contradicted the propaganda that he focuses on the transport infrastructure alone. His ability and strength to work round-the-clock on projects, all the while not losing focus on any of them is what makes him stand above the ministers and civil servants around him.

Esteemed Projects for Public Service

While being blamed by critics for ignoring the health sector, his unprecedented control of the dengue breakout was perhaps his most appreciated achievement both nationally and internationally. The budget for health was increased by 500 per cent during his tenure. His unplanned visits managed to keep the entire governance on its toes, achieving results his counterparts in our provinces could not. This was at times mocked by his rivals, yet proved fruitful for the efficient running of systems.

The Pakistan Kidney and Liver Institute and Research Centre (PKLI) was inaugurated under his supervision in December 2017, so as to cater to the large number of poor patients suffering from hepatic and renal diseases. Medical colleges were set up in smaller cities like Sahiwal and cardiology centres in Bahawalpur and Faisalabad. In his tenure, 125 district and 40 divisional headquarters hospitals were modernized and equipped with state of the art equipment such as CT scan machines. Intensive training was also provided to the paramedic staff, outsourcing departments dealing with expensive diagnostic services.

Considered a competent individual, Shahbaz attained evident success in the developmental work, with the Metro Bus and Orange Line Train projects in Punjab frequently regarded as one of his biggest achievements. Even many of his most fierce rivals do not fail to talk about his development in infrastructure, for example as of the Punjab Mass Transit Authority. He also added to the housing sector by launching the Ashiana Housing Scheme as well as the setup of Model villages specifically for those affected by floods.

When facing the severe energy crisis of 2013 with Punjab being the most affected region, the Punjab government was in a short time span able to add about 3200 –MW to the national grid. Massive power production projects were launched by Shahbaz Sharif which was acknowledged by development giants like Turkey and China. While working on projects like the 1320-MW Sahiwal Coal Power Plant and 135-MW Tunsa Hydro Power Plant amongst many, Shahbaz Sharif also claims to have saved hundreds of billions of national wealth on these. The Haveli Lakha project whereas has been acknowledged as the fastest built project of its capacity, all over the world.
